WebDec 24, 2024 · Using the network reset utility in Windows 10 is fairly simple. Go to Start menu > Settings, then select Network and Internet . In the left navigation pane, select Status to make sure you're viewing the network status window. Then scroll down until you see the Network Reset link. Just select the ... under the net reviewWebDec 10, 2024 · Go to System>Recovery options at the end. Under Recovery options, click Reset PC. Reset options in Windows 11, now in System Settings, instead of Update and Security Select if you want to keep your files or remove the files. Removing the files is helpful if you plan to donate or sell your computer. I am selecting to keep my files in this example. under the net by iris murdoch
